Ingredients
Explore the therapeutic blend of active ingredients that make this tablet a potent solution for cold and flu symptoms:
Triple Action Relief: Each Coldaway-C tablet combines 200 mg of ibuprofen, 30 mg of pseudoephedrine hydrochloride, and 300 mg of ascorbic acid (vitamin C) for a threefold approach to symptom relief.

Mechanism of Action
Gain insight into how Coldaway-C works to combat cold and flu symptoms:
Ibuprofen Power: As a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ID), ibuprofen possesses analgesic and antipyretic properties, effectively reducing fever and alleviating headaches and body aches.
Pseudoephedrine Relief: Pseudoephedrine acts as a potent decongestant, narrowing blood vessels in nasal passages to provide relief from nasal congestion.

Precautions
Understand essential precautions when using this tablet:
Allergic Sensitivities: If you are allergic to ibuprofen, pseudoephedrine hydrochloride, or any excipients in the product, refrain from using Coldaway-C.
History of Blood Cell Count Decrease: Individuals with a history of severe blood cell count decrease should avoid this tablet.
Side Effects
Explore potential side effects associated with Coldaway-C and their occurrence:
Mild and Temporary Effects: Common side effects include irritability, insomnia, dizziness, headache, dry mouth, nausea, vomiting, abdominal pain, and diarrhea.
Seeking Medical Attention: Although side effects are generally mild and temporary, if severe or persistent symptoms occur, seek medical attention promptly.
